About this home

Welcome to this stunning single story end unit freshly painted kitchen and interior walls. Perfectly situated for both comfort and convenience just off of Beach Blvd. Step inside to discover upgraded laminate flooring and tile that flows seamlessly throughout the main living areas. The spacious layout features two inviting bedrooms and two beautifully remodeled bathrooms, offering modern amenities and stylish finishes. The home is within a mile or so of Trade Joe's, Terraza Park, La Habra Towne Center, La Habra Marketplace, Imperial Promenade, Beach Commerce Center, Palm Court, and West Ridge Golf Club. Part of award winning school district Lowell Joint. Enjoy year-round comfort with central air conditioning, ensuring a cool retreat during the warmer months. The backyard is a true highlight, complete with a charming wood pergola, ideal for outdoor entertaining or relaxing in your private oasis. Condition Rating
Fair

The property was built in 1976, but the description mentions remodeled bathrooms and fresh paint. The kitchen appears functional but somewhat dated with older appliances and cabinet styles. The flooring is upgraded laminate and tile. Overall, it appears maintained but not recently fully renovated, placing it in the 'fair' condition category.
